--- Begin Message ---Hi guys, I'm catching up on gNewSense bugs and I'm now looking at the Mersenne Twister bug [1] again. At the time it was found to be under the Artistic License. At Rubén's request the copyright holders relicensed it to GPL [2]. At what I think is the current homepage of the implementation [3] I found old GPL versions [4]. The "newest version of original authors" [5] is licensed under the Modified BSD license. File crypto/mersenne/mt19937db.c in Trisquel's db4.8 looks like it's still the one from the upstream Berkeley DB project, carrying the Artistic License notice. The recommended fix in the NONFSDG list [6] says to either remove the package or use a GPL version of the file. So far, gNewSense and Trisquel have done neither. What do you see as a solution, considering that packages like exim4-base depend on db and replacing the file means reintegrating it without looking too hard at the current file in db?
